it is a cheap looking hacked together piece of equipment. not much to look at but I think my eastwood powdercoating kit has got to earn a spot as one of the coolest tools on the planet. now I know there are lots of cool tools out there. but I mean I take these ugly rusted taillight buckets. spend a little time with the bead blaster and then chrome powdercoat them and they look better than new. it is such a hokey funky looking tool but it works so well. I just love the thing.

so what are some of your very favorite oddball tools.

I love my Eastwood Hot Coat gun too! Woot! Can you tell me which chrome powder you're having luck with? I'm also curious if you topcoat it. I "chromed" some things with powder last year but without a top coat, they've turned gray about a year later.
